New Gift Shop to Feature Michigan-Made Products
Ypsilanti, MI – Call it a revolution. Businesses like Starbucks and McDonalds are found on almost every street corner in the U.S. and expand throughout the globe to locations such as China and Japan. The Eyrie, founded by Janette Rook, is a store that goes against the grain as it remains un-globalized and is completely based on Michigan-made products.
“This is the kind of store that I’ve wanted to shop at for a while,” Rook said.
The Eyrie, located on 9 E. Cross St. in Ypsilanti, can be easily distinguished by its blue awning and green door. The shop is described on its website as “A gift shop featuring Michigan artisans and sundries in Ypsilanti’s Depot Town.”
